The Receivables Turnover ratio meas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ance. It is calculated as Revenue divided by average Accounts Receivable. An efficient company has a higher accounts receivable turnover ratio while an inefficient company has a lower ratio. Pine Cliff Energy's Revenue for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was €28.5 Mil. Pine Cliff Energy's average Accounts Receivable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was €12.6 Mil. Hence, Pine Cliff Energy's Receivables Turnover for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 2.27.

Pine Cliff Energy Receivables Turnover Calculation

Receivables Turnover meas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ance.

Pine Cliff Energy's Receivables Turnover for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(A: Dec. 2025 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2025 )) / count )
=110.099 / ((15.888 + 12.865) / 2 )
=110.099 / 14.3765
=7.66

Pine Cliff Energy's Receivables Turnover for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(Q: Dec. 2025 ) + Accounts Receivable (Q: Mar. 2026 )) / count )
=28.517 / ((12.865 + 12.303) / 2 )
=28.517 / 12.584
=2.27

Pine Cliff Energy Ltd. is engaged in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of natural gas and crude oil in the Western Canadian Sedimentary Basin and conducts many of its activities jointly with others. The company has various operations and assets, such as Central Assets, Edson Assets, Southern Assets, and others.
